Well what I really like about Windows XP compared to 98 is the speed difference. I never bought Windows ME or anything else after Windows 98 until XP. Anyway after finally replacing Windows 98 with Windows XP the bootup time was incredibly faster. I am able to boot up in about 20 seconds now on a 1.2 ghz, 1 gig ram, 64 meg vidoe card, computer. I have found it to be more stable too. But then again its just my opinion.

processor speed is debatable, but I would SERIOUSLY RECOMMEND not having less
than 256mb of RAM. Otherwise, it sucks it dry too quickly. Other than that, I am
a HUGE fan of WinXP.
